Compare all specifications:

2005 Hyundai Elantra 2007 Renault Megane
Make Hyundai Renault
Model Elantra Megane
Year Released 2005 2007
Body Type Sedan Hatchback
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1995 cc 1998 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 139 HP 134 HP
Engine RPM 5800 RPM 5500 RPM
Torque 184 Nm 191 Nm
Engine Bore Size 82 mm 82.7 mm
Engine Stroke Size 93 mm 93 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 10.1:1 11.5:1
Drive Type Front Front
Number of Seats 5 seats 4 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 3 doors
Vehicle Weight 1195 kg 1305 kg
Vehicle Length 4530 mm 4220 mm
Vehicle Width 1730 mm 1780 mm
Vehicle Height 1430 mm 1460 mm
Wheelbase Size 2740 mm 2630 mm
Fuel Consumption Overall 8 L/100km 8.1 L/100km
Fuel Tank Capacity 55 L 60 L
